  • Raspberry Pi Pico is included:Raspberry Pi Pico is a micro-controller board based on the Raspberry Pi RP2040 micro-controller chip. It has been designed to be a low-cost, high-performance micro-controller board with flexible digital interfaces.It features Dual-core Arm Cortex M0+ processor, flexible clock running up to 133 MHz. 264KB of SRAM, and 2MB of on-board Flash memory.
